A thick, healthy lawn is something almost every homeowner wants. Dense turf not only looks beautiful, but it also helps prevent weeds, improves drought resistance, and creates a softer outdoor space for your family.

If your lawn looks thin or patchy, the good news is that there are several proven ways to improve turf density in Michigan.

Here are the most effective ways to grow a thicker lawn.

Mow at the Proper Height

One of the easiest ways to improve lawn thickness is simply mowing correctly.

For most Michigan lawns, grass should be maintained at 3–3.5 inches tall.

Taller grass blades allow the lawn to:

• Develop deeper roots
• Retain soil moisture
• Shade out weeds
• Produce thicker turf

Cutting grass too short weakens the lawn and makes it easier for weeds to take over.

Mow Consistently

Regular mowing encourages grass plants to grow laterally, which helps fill in thin areas.

Weekly mowing during the growing season promotes thicker turf and keeps the lawn looking clean and professional.

Consistent mowing is one of the simplest ways to improve lawn density over time.

Apply Fertilizer at the Right Time

Grass needs nutrients to grow thick and healthy.

Applying fertilizer in spring and fall provides the nutrients lawns need to grow stronger roots and fuller turf.

Fall fertilization is especially important for cool-season grasses in Michigan.

Overseed Thin Areas

Overseeding is the process of spreading new grass seed into an existing lawn.

This helps fill in bare spots and improve overall turf density.

Early fall is typically the best time to overseed lawns in Michigan because temperatures are cooler and soil conditions are ideal for germination.

Improve Soil Health

Healthy soil produces healthy grass.

If soil becomes compacted, roots struggle to absorb water and nutrients.

Aeration helps relieve compaction and allows air, water, and nutrients to reach the root zone more effectively.
